NDPlatform serves as a national HRH database as well as multi-partner base at the global level. The ongoing inititaives at the global level (IADEX, Nursing Now campaign) prioritising health workforce and the need for updated information on health workforce data, pins the NDPlatform as the common repository of the multi-agency data hosting site.For effective collaboration of this high level multi agency engagement and DG initiatives it was critical to have the data publicly available an easily accessible. To serve this objective, the NHWA data portal (NDPortal, ), based on POwerBI was launched in 2020.
With the increased uptake of NDPlatform among Member States and the NDPortal , it has emerged as the leading source of health workforce statistics. The sustained and continuous technical support to countries including the data updates and maintenance of both the NDPlatform and the NDPortal, based on live user feedback, is crucial to the implementation of the technical area of work and the broader health workforce agenda.Deliverables
